Patent number: 9664493Abstract: The invention relates to a production plant (1), in particular for folding workpieces (2) to be produced from sheet metal, comprising a bending press (3), in particular a press brake, having a press beam (13, 16), at least one bending tool (4), such as a bending punch (5) and bending die (6), which is connected to the press beam (13, 16), and at least one angle-measuring device (46) for determining an angular position of at least one limb (35, 36) of the workpiece (2) formed by a bending operation relative to a reference plane (41, 42). The angle-measuring device (46) comprises at least one inclination sensor (39) having a reference surface (40) and the inclination sensor (39) is mounted by the angle-measuring device (46) so that it can be placed with the reference surface (40) lying in contact with a surface portion of at least one of the limbs (35, 36) of the workpiece (2).Type: GrantFiled: June 12, 2013Date of Patent: May 30, 2017Assignee: TRUMPF Maschinen Austria GmbH & Co. Patent number: 9547300Abstract: The invention relates to a machine controller comprising a sensor module (4), an evaluation module (9) and a control module (5), and the sensor module (4) has a convertor which converts a mechanical variable acting on the sensor module (4) into a proportional electric characteristic variable, and the evaluation module (9) is connected via a first signal connection (8) to the sensor module (4) and via a second signal connection (11) to the control module (5). The evaluation module (9) generates a signal profile from the detected electric signal by means of an analysis of potential and/or change, which is compared with at least one reference signal profile stored in a memory means of the evaluation module (9) by means of a comparison module of the evaluation module (9), from which the control signal is generated. Furthermore, at least one of the two signal connections (8, 11) is based on a wireless design.Type: GrantFiled: December 19, 2011Date of Patent: January 17, 2017Assignee: TRUMPF Maschinen Austria GmbH & Co. Patent number: 8424359Abstract: The invention describes a manufacturing device (1) and a method for bending blanks (4) or workpieces (5), having a bending press (2) and having a manipulator (3), which can be displaced in a raceway parallel to a longitudinal extent of a table and bending beam (10, 14), for workpiece transfer between a feeding or removal apparatus for the blanks (4) or the workpieces (5) and a forming region between bending tools (21). The manipulator (3) has an articulated-arm arrangement (33) having preferably three arms (34, 35, 36) which can be pivoted via pivoting bearing arrangements (37) about pivot axes (39) which are oriented parallel to the raceway, and said manipulator has a rotary unit (41), having a rotational axis (42) which extends perpendicularly with respect to the pivot axes (39), at one distal end of the articulated-arm arrangement (33).Type: GrantFiled: January 4, 2007Date of Patent: April 23, 2013Assignee: TRUMPF Maschinen Austria GmbH & Co. Patent number: 7792609Abstract: A gripping device for a manipulation system, particularly a robot, for receiving workpieces and feeding them from a readied stack of the workpieces to a manufacturing plant such as a metal sheet folding machine, punching press, welding plant, etc. The device has a gripper head fitted with gripping means such as suction cups, magnets, tongs, etc., and a detection system for detecting characteristics of the workpiece gripped by the gripping means. A pulse emitter excites vibrations in the workpiece and the vibration spectrum of the workpiece is compared to reference vibration data to determine characteristics of the gripped workpiece, such as whether two or more workpieces are stuck together, or whether the workpiece is the correct workpiece.Type: GrantFiled: September 25, 2003Date of Patent: September 7, 2010Assignee: Trumpf Maschinen Austria GmbH & Co. Patent number: 6938454Abstract: A manufacturing system for folding sheet bars, particularly sheet metal bars, comprising a folding press with two press beams, which are adjustable in relation to each other and provided with folding dies, whereby the folding press is fed by means of an automated manipulating system. The manipulating system has three hinged arms connected via pivoting devices to form an arrangement of hinged arms. A first hinged arm is swivel-mounted on a swivel axle extending in a swivel device parallel to a guide track of a linearly displaceable chassis. A second and a third swivel axles supporting the hinged arms are arranged extending parallel to the swivel axle of the swivel device. A gripping system and a seizing device for picking up the sheet bars are arranged in another end area of the hinged-arm arrangement. A positioning device assures that the sheet bar is correctly positioned for the folding process.Type: GrantFiled: November 11, 2004Date of Patent: September 6, 2005Assignee: TRUMPF Maschinen Austria GmbH & Co.
